"""Reference helpers for the "Thesis" / "Dissertation" resource type change (v14).

These functions are reference material, not a runnable script. They are here so
you can copy and adapt the parts that fit your instance when carrying out the
*optional* resource type change described in the v14 upgrade guide. Read them,
lift what you need into your own `invenio shell` snippet or script, and always
test against a copy of your data first.

Two independent operations are shown:

- `run_update_for_resource_type` rewrites every published record and unpublished
draft with resource type publication-thesis to publication-dissertation (in
metadata.resource_type and in any metadata.related_identifiers), going through
the service layer so DataCite DOI metadata is re-registered and records are
re-indexed.

- `run_update_doi_metadata_for_resource_type` re-registers the DataCite DOI
metadata of every published record of a resource type, without changing the
record. Use it when you keep your own resource type id but changed its
props.datacite_general (e.g. to "Dissertation") in your vocabulary: the DataCite
serializer reads props.datacite_general live from the vocabulary, so only a DOI
update is needed.

The resource type rewrite has been tested for the following scenarios:
1. Draft with resource type publication-thesis
2. Record with resource type publication-thesis with a DOI and no draft
3. Record with resource type publication-thesis with no DOI and an existing draft
4. Records with multiple versions
"""

from click import secho
from invenio_access.permissions import system_identity
from invenio_db import db
from invenio_drafts_resources.resources.records.errors import DraftNotCreatedError
from invenio_rdm_records.proxies import current_rdm_records_service as records_service
from invenio_rdm_records.services.errors import RecordDeletedException
from invenio_search.api import RecordsSearchV2


def run_upgrade(migrate_record, migrate_draft):
"""Run upgrade on selected records and drafts.

Args:
migrate_record (callable): Function to migrate a record.
migrate_draft (callable): Function to migrate a draft.
"""
errored_record_ids = []
errored_draft_ids = []

# Handle published records
published_records = (
RecordsSearchV2(index=records_service.record_cls.index._name)
.filter(
"query_string",
query="metadata.resource_type.id:publication-thesis OR metadata.related_identifiers.resource_type.id:publication-thesis",
)
.source(["id"])
.scan()
) # Only need to fetch the record IDs to make the query faster
# Convert the search results to a list to avoid keeping the scroll context open, as it errors out after 15 minutes
published_record_ids = [result["id"] for result in published_records]
for record_id in published_record_ids:
try:
migrate_record(record_id)
except Exception as error:
secho(f"> Error {repr(error)}", fg="red")
secho(f"Record {record_id} failed to update", fg="red")
errored_record_ids.append((record_id, error))

# Handle draft records
draft_records = (
RecordsSearchV2(index=records_service.draft_cls.index._name)
.filter("term", has_draft=False)
.filter(
"query_string",
query="metadata.resource_type.id:publication-thesis OR metadata.related_identifiers.resource_type.id:publication-thesis",
)
.source(["id"])
.scan()
)
# Convert the search results to a list to avoid keeping the scroll context open, as it errors out after 15 minutes
draft_record_ids = [result["id"] for result in draft_records]
for draft_id in draft_record_ids:
try:
migrate_draft(draft_id)
except Exception as error:
secho(f"> Error {repr(error)}", fg="red")
secho(f"Draft {draft_id} failed to update", fg="red")
errored_draft_ids.append((draft_id, error))

if len(errored_record_ids) > 0:
secho(f"Errored record IDs: {errored_record_ids}", fg="red")
else:
secho("records have been updated successfully", fg="green")

if len(errored_draft_ids) > 0:
secho(f"Errored draft IDs: {errored_draft_ids}", fg="red")
else:
secho("drafts have been updated successfully", fg="green")


def run_update_for_resource_type():
"""Run update for resource type."""

def migrate_resource_type_in_record(record_id):
"""
Update resource type from publication-thesis to publication-dissertation.

We go through the service layer to automatically trigger the DOI update and re-indexing.
"""
secho(f"Updating resource type for record {record_id}", fg="yellow")
record = records_service.read(system_identity, record_id, include_deleted=True)
if record.data["metadata"]["resource_type"][
"id"
] != "publication-thesis" and not any(
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
for related_identifier in record.data["metadata"].get(
"related_identifiers", []
)
):
secho(
f"Skipping record <{record.id}> because it doesn't have resource-type 'publication-thesis'!",
fg="yellow",
)
return

try:
draft = records_service.read_draft(system_identity, record.id)
# Step 1: Update the resource type in the record via low-level API
# We need to make sure we don't publish the record with different metadata
secho(
f"Record <{record.id}> has an existing draft <{draft.id}>! Updating record via low-level API.",
fg="yellow",
)
# Update the record directly without affecting the draft
if (
record._record["metadata"]["resource_type"]["id"]
== "publication-thesis"
):
record._record["metadata"]["resource_type"][
"id"
] = "publication-dissertation"
for related_identifier in record._record["metadata"].get(
"related_identifiers", []
):
if (
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
):
related_identifier["resource_type"][
"id"
] = "publication-dissertation"
# Save the record changes and reindex
secho(
f"Record <{record.id}> has been updated... committing changes.",
fg="green",
)
record._record.commit()
# Step 2: Update the resource type in the draft
if draft._record["metadata"]["resource_type"]["id"] == "publication-thesis":
draft._record["metadata"]["resource_type"][
"id"
] = "publication-dissertation"
for related_identifier in draft._record["metadata"].get(
"related_identifiers", []
):
if (
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
):
related_identifier["resource_type"][
"id"
] = "publication-dissertation"
# After updating the record, update the draft's fork_version_id to match the record's new version_id, to avoid conflicts when publishing
draft._record.fork_version_id = record._record.revision_id
draft._record.commit()
# Commit the changes for both the record and the draft in one transaction
db.session.commit()
records_service.indexer.index(record._record)
records_service.draft_indexer.index(draft._record)
secho(f"Draft <{draft.id}> has been updated successfully.", fg="green")
# Update DOI metadata if record has DOI
if (record._record.get("pids") or {}).get("doi"):
records_service.pids.register_or_update(
system_identity, record.id, "doi", parent=False
)
secho(
f"DOI metadata for record {record.id} has been updated successfully.",
fg="green",
)
except DraftNotCreatedError:
# If the draft didn't exist, we simply edit and publish the record
draft = records_service.edit(system_identity, record.id)
if draft.data["metadata"]["resource_type"]["id"] == "publication-thesis":
draft.data["metadata"]["resource_type"][
"id"
] = "publication-dissertation"
for related_identifier in draft.data["metadata"].get(
"related_identifiers", []
):
if (
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
):
related_identifier["resource_type"][
"id"
] = "publication-dissertation"
updated_draft = records_service.update_draft(
system_identity, draft.id, draft.data
)
record = records_service.publish(system_identity, updated_draft.id)
except RecordDeletedException:
# If the draft was deleted, we ignore it
# In the future, we should add include_deleted to read_draft and update the draft metadata in these cases
secho(f"Draft <{draft.id}> has been deleted, skipping...", fg="yellow")

secho(f"Record <{record.id}> has been updated successfully.", fg="green")

def migrate_resource_type_in_draft(draft_id):
"""
Update resource type from publication-thesis to publication-dissertation.

We go through the service layer to automatically trigger the DOI update and re-indexing.
"""
secho(f"Updating resource type for draft {draft_id}", fg="yellow")
draft = records_service.edit(system_identity, draft_id)
if draft.data["metadata"]["resource_type"][
"id"
] != "publication-thesis" and not any(
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
for related_identifier in draft.data["metadata"].get(
"related_identifiers", []
)
):
secho(
f"Skipping draft <{draft.id}> because it doesn't have resource-type 'publication-thesis'!",
fg="yellow",
)
return

if draft.data["metadata"]["resource_type"]["id"] == "publication-thesis":
draft.data["metadata"]["resource_type"]["id"] = "publication-dissertation"
for related_identifier in draft.data["metadata"].get("related_identifiers", []):
if (
related_identifier.get("resource_type", {}).get("id")
== "publication-thesis"
):
related_identifier["resource_type"]["id"] = "publication-dissertation"
updated_draft = records_service.update_draft(
system_identity, draft.id, draft.data
)
secho(f"Draft <{updated_draft.id}> has been updated successfully.", fg="green")

secho("Resource type update has started.", fg="green")

run_upgrade(
migrate_resource_type_in_record,
migrate_resource_type_in_draft,
)

secho("Resource type update has finished.", fg="green")


def run_update_doi_metadata_for_resource_type(resource_type_id="publication-thesis"):
"""Re-register DataCite DOI metadata for published records of a resource type.

Use this after changing the resource type's props.datacite_general in your
vocabulary and reloading the fixture. The DataCite serializer reads
props.datacite_general live from the vocabulary, so re-registering each DOI
pushes the new value to DataCite; the records are not otherwise changed. Only
version DOIs are refreshed here (pass parent=True to also update the concept
DOI).
"""
secho(
f"DOI metadata update for resource type {resource_type_id} has started.",
fg="green",
)

errored_record_ids = []

published_records = (
RecordsSearchV2(index=records_service.record_cls.index._name)
.filter(
"query_string",
query=f"metadata.resource_type.id:{resource_type_id} OR metadata.related_identifiers.resource_type.id:{resource_type_id}",
)
.source(["id"])
.scan()
)
# Convert the search results to a list to avoid keeping the scroll context open, as it errors out after 15 minutes
published_record_ids = [result["id"] for result in published_records]
for record_id in published_record_ids:
try:
record = records_service.read(system_identity, record_id)
# Only records that already have a DOI can have their metadata updated
if not (record._record.get("pids") or {}).get("doi"):
secho(
f"Skipping record <{record_id}> because it has no DOI!",
fg="yellow",
)
continue
records_service.pids.register_or_update(
system_identity, record_id, "doi", parent=False
)
secho(
f"DOI metadata for record {record_id} has been updated successfully.",
fg="green",
)
except Exception as error:
secho(f"> Error {repr(error)}", fg="red")
secho(f"Record {record_id} failed to update", fg="red")
errored_record_ids.append((record_id, error))

if len(errored_record_ids) > 0:
secho(f"Errored record IDs: {errored_record_ids}", fg="red")
else:
secho("DOI metadata has been updated successfully", fg="green")
